About this position

The University of Oslo is advertising a PhD Research Fellow in Machine Learning for Cognitive Neuroscience (ref 306376). The project focuses on developing machine learning models and frameworks for time series analysis to better understand how the human brain encodes information.

The position is based in the Digital Signal Processing and Image Analysis group (DSB) in the Section for Machine Learning, Department of Informatics, at the University of Oslo. The wider research environment includes work in image analysis, machine learning, digital signal processing, and acoustic imaging, with a large group of postdocs and PhD fellows supported by national and international funding and industry partnerships.

This is a cross-disciplinary collaboration between the DSB group at the Section for Machine Learning (IFI) and the Group for Cognitive Neurophysiology at the Medical Faculty. The team also has research links with Bradley Voytek at the Halıcıoğlu Data Science Institute, University of California San Diego, USA.
